Grammar usage guide and real-world examplesUSAGE SUMMARY
The phrase "is interesting reading" is correct and usable in written English.
You can use it to describe a text or material that captures attention and engages the reader. Example: "The article on climate change is interesting reading for anyone concerned about the environment."

Expert writing Tips
Best practice
Use "is interesting reading" to introduce a topic or text that is likely to capture the reader's attention and encourage further exploration. It's effective for setting expectations and creating interest.
Common error
While "is interesting reading" is generally acceptable, excessive use in formal reports or academic papers can make your writing seem less sophisticated. Opt for synonyms like "offers valuable insights" or "provides a comprehensive analysis" in professional settings.

FAQs
What can I say instead of "is interesting reading"?
You can use alternatives like "is a captivating read", "is an engaging read", or "is a worthwhile read" depending on the context.
How to use "is interesting reading" in a sentence?
Use "is interesting reading" to describe a text, article, or book that you find engaging and worth exploring, for example: "The study on renewable energy is interesting reading for policymakers".
Is "is interesting to read" the same as "is interesting reading"?
While both phrases convey a similar meaning, "is interesting reading" is generally used to describe the quality of the material itself, while "is interesting to read" focuses on the act of reading it.
When is it appropriate to use the phrase "is interesting reading"?
It's suitable for various contexts, including informal recommendations, reviews, and discussions where you want to highlight the engaging nature of a particular text.
